Biography

Birth

Sarah was born on 21 January 1699/1700 in Wrentham Massachusetts Bay Colony. She was the daughter of Andrew Blake and Sarah Stevens. [1]

Marriage

Sarah married Benjamin Morse on 14 February 1726/27 in Wrentham. [1]

Children

Her children are listed on her husband's profile.

Death

Sarah passed away on 19 November 1788 at Wrentham. [1]
